Best Ways to Reach Apex Healthcare's Hiring Team

LinkedIn

Search for Apex Healthcare recruiters and hiring managers on LinkedIn. Even without an official company page, Apex Healthcare employees likely have individual profiles where they share job opportunities.

  • Search LinkedIn for "recruiter Apex Healthcare" or "HR Apex Healthcare"
  • Look for Apex Healthcare employees in hiring-related roles
  • Send personalized connection requests with specific role mentions

Email

Find Apex Healthcare recruiter emails through LinkedIn (some show in bios) or use email finder tools. Professional email outreach can be effective if done thoughtfully.

  • Check LinkedIn profiles for email addresses in the contact section
  • Use email subject: "Interested in Opportunities at Apex Healthcare"
  • Reference a specific Apex Healthcare role in your message

Professional Networks

Reach Apex Healthcare's team through industry events, alumni networks, or professional associations. Warm introductions to Apex Healthcare employees can be more effective than cold outreach.

  • Look for Apex Healthcare employees at industry meetups or events
  • Check if your university has alumni at Apex Healthcare
  • Ask for introductions from mutual connections to Apex Healthcare

Do's for Contacting Apex Healthcare

  • Research Apex Healthcare thoroughly before reaching out - know their products, recent news, and culture
  • Reference a specific position or department at Apex Healthcare that interests you
  • Personalize each message - mention why Apex Healthcare specifically excites you
  • Check if the Apex Healthcare recruiter has posted content you can reference
  • Time your outreach - contact Apex Healthcare Tuesday-Thursday mornings for best results
  • Be upfront about your visa status when discussing opportunities at Apex Healthcare

Don'ts to Avoid

  • Send generic copy-paste messages without personalizing for Apex Healthcare
  • Contact multiple Apex Healthcare recruiters or hiring managers simultaneously
  • Be pushy or follow up more than twice without a response
  • Use overly casual language when reaching out to Apex Healthcare
  • Reach out to Apex Healthcare executives directly for entry-level roles

Apex Healthcare Recruiter Contact FAQ

How do I find the right recruiter at Apex Healthcare?

Search LinkedIn for "Apex Healthcare" employees with "recruiter," "talent," or "HR" in their titles. Job postings from Apex Healthcare sometimes include the hiring manager's name. You can also check Apex Healthcare's website for team or contact pages.

When is the best time to reach out to Apex Healthcare recruiters?

Tuesday through Thursday mornings (9-11 AM in the recruiter's timezone) typically see the highest response rates. Avoid Mondays when Apex Healthcare recruiters are catching up on emails, and Fridays when they're wrapping up the week.

Should I contact Apex Healthcare recruiters before or after applying?

Apply to Apex Healthcare through official channels first, then reach out to a recruiter referencing your application. This shows initiative and gives Apex Healthcare's recruiter something to look up. Mention the role title and date you applied.

Should I connect with Apex Healthcare employees who aren't recruiters?

Yes! Connecting with Apex Healthcare team members in your target department can provide insights and potentially an internal referral. Apex Healthcare employees often share job openings with their network. Start by engaging with their content before sending a connection request.
